General Discussion / Re: Can OCTGN work on a MacBook?
« on: May 22, 2017, 02:50:02 PM »
I ran windows on apple computers for years without any problems. Bootcamp lets you install it and provides all drivers. You just have to choose how much percent windows should be (you dont have to format the drive, bootcamp manages to maintain your osx plus data), bootcamp prepares the windows partition (format, UEFI and stuff), ive never had problems with that.
You can buy a Windows 7 Pro licence for 10$ and upgrade to Windows 10.
So you are 10$ and an afternoon of installations away from Mage Wars :)

Strategy and Tactics / To give or to keep first initiative
« on: March 19, 2017, 09:14:25 AM »
Some short notes on this "first initiative" thing:
When I started the game I thought the higher effect die wins and gets first initiative: "Horray, I can start first!"
Then came a longer period where it was clear to give first ini if you win it to be able to see what the opponent does in R1 and to be able to react on that: "Always give first ini except you planned something special where you have to have ini in round x"
At the moment I tend to keep first ini for the following reasons:
Most of the times I stick to my planned first round anyway (based on my main strategy and biased by the opponents choice of mage). Often, the choice of mage implies more than his play in R1 (polemic: the info that it is a necro has more value than knowing that somebody plays a crystal in R1)
Even faster decks often start with something "uncertain" like flower + Wynchwood faery (e.g. the nasty Beastmaster by s3chaos), so if its not a super fast deck it often still can lead anywhere after R1. So if he starts action in R2 after minimal economy in R1 I like to have the info right there to be able to react on that. If he continues building up in R2 I can assume that he will play slow(er).
Therefore, the information advatage in round two has often more value than in round one. Completely excluding timed rush decks (on both sides) of course.
To quote some young mage who thinks about paladin openings all day: "Any thoughts?"
